All the ads running on Catsailor are supplied by the Google Adwords program. There shouldn't be any NSFW type ads at all. The ads Google serves to a particular browser session depend on the context of the page and the browsing habits of the visitor.
I mostly see ads for software, shopping, and outdoor stuff.
There are no popups, pop-overs, pop-unders or anything like that running on the site, so if anyone sees anything like that it is probably a problem (malware) with your computer/browser.
If you do spot an ad that you don't like for any reason, look at the top right of the ad and there is a little X or the AdChoices symbol, if you click carefully on that you get the choice to report the ad.

Mike, could you send me a screenshot of the ads you find objectionable? Not sure what you consider NSFW, pornsite ads? You can use a PM or email me with damon at this site.
I don't have any control over which specific ads appear from the Google Adsense program, but it's possible to stop a category like alcohol or gambling.
Using software to block ads on website will only cause problems viewing and using the site since they block the loading of javascripts that also provide needed functionality. Also, blocking tracking cookies can produce the very problem you are having, since Google has no way of knowing what ads are relevant to you.
More practically, if there was indeed a good way to block ads then you remove the only small income that this site produces.
